What is a Membership Agreement?

A Membership Agreement sets out the rules, rights, and responsibilities between an organization and its members. Common in clubs, societies, gyms, and professional associations across England and Wales, it creates a legally binding relationship that protects both sides.

These contracts spell out key details like membership fees, access to facilities, voting rights, and grounds for termination. Under English contract law, they're especially important for organizations structured as companies limited by guarantee, where members take on specific obligations and liabilities. Good agreements help prevent disputes by making expectations crystal clear from day one.

When should you use a Membership Agreement?

A Membership Agreement becomes essential when launching or running any organization where people join as members—from private clubs and gyms to professional associations and trade bodies. It's particularly vital for companies limited by guarantee under English law, where members take on specific rights and obligations.

Use this agreement when setting up membership schemes, changing existing membership terms, or bringing in new categories of members. It provides critical protection during disputes, helps enforce payment obligations, and ensures compliance with consumer protection laws. Many organizations implement them before opening doors or when scaling up operations to avoid future complications.

What should be included in a Membership Agreement?

  • Party Details: Full legal names and addresses of both the organisation and member
  • Membership Terms: Clear definition of rights, privileges, and duration of membership
  • Payment Provisions: Fee structure, payment schedules, and consequences of non-payment
  • Termination Clauses: Conditions for ending membership and notice periods
  • Data Protection: GDPR compliance statements and data handling procedures
  • Dispute Resolution: Process for handling disagreements under English law
  • Liability Limits: Clear boundaries of organisational and member responsibilities
  • Signature Block: Space for dated signatures and witness details if required

What's the difference between a Membership Agreement and an Access Agreement?

Membership Agreements are often confused with Access Agreements, but they serve distinct purposes in English law. While both govern the relationship between an organization and individuals, their scope and legal implications differ significantly.

  • Access Agreement: Focuses solely on entry and usage rights to specific facilities or resources, typically for a fixed period or particular purpose
  • Legal Obligations: Membership Agreements create ongoing mutual obligations and rights, while Access Agreements are limited to facility use and safety rules
  • Duration and Scope: Membership Agreements establish long-term relationships with recurring benefits and responsibilities; Access Agreements are often shorter-term or project-specific
  • Governance Rights: Membership Agreements may include voting rights and organizational participation; Access Agreements rarely contain such provisions
  • Termination Process: Membership Agreements require formal procedures for ending the relationship; Access Agreements typically end automatically after the specified period
